Das Erstellen von Segmenten mit der UND/ODER-Logik kann oft verwirrend sein, insbesondere wenn die Segmentergebnisse Informationen anzeigen, die Sie nicht erwarten. In diesem Dokument erläutern wir sowohl „UND“-Logik als auch „ODER“-Logik und erklären, wie sie jeweils bei der Verwendung positiver Bedingungen (z. B. ist in Liste, Tag existiert usw.) und negativer Bedingungen (z. B. nicht in Liste, Tag existiert nicht usw.) funktionieren.
Beispielkontakte
In diesem Artikel verwenden wir die folgenden Beispielkontakte und -Tags, um zu erklären, wie die einzelnen Operatoren in einem Segment funktionieren:
- Jane Doe – Tags: engagiert, Champion, neu
- Martino Doe – Tags: engagiert
- Macy Doe – Tags: keine
„UND“-Logikbedingung
Mit der „UND“-Logikbedingung bezieht unser System Kontakte ein, die alle Bedingungen in Ihrem Segment erfüllen. Durch die Verwendung der „UND“-Logik wird die Anzahl der übereinstimmenden Kontakte eingeschränkt, da jede dieser Bedingungen erfüllt sein muss.
Nachfolgend finden Sie drei Beispiele zur Veranschaulichung der „UND“-Logik und der zu erwartenden Ergebnisse:
Beispiel 1: „UND“-Logik mit positiven Bedingungen
Angenommen, Sie erstellen ein Segment, das die „UND“-Logik mit den folgenden positiven Bedingungen verwendet:
Unser System sucht und schließt Kontakte ein, die alle drei Bedingungen erfüllen. Ein Kontakt, der mindestens eine der drei Bedingungen nicht erfüllt, wird nicht in das Segment aufgenommen.
Anwendungsfall mit Beispielkontakten
So funktioniert es anhand der Beispielkontakte und dem Bild oben:
- Jane Doe ist der einzige Kontakt, der in diesem Zustand angezeigt wird. Sie ist der einzige Kontakt mit allen drei Tags: „engagiert“, „Champion“ und „neu“. Sie erfüllt daher alle drei Bedingungen.
Beispiel 2: „UND“-Logik mit negativen Bedingungen
Nehmen wir nun an, Sie erstellen ein Segment mithilfe der „UND“-Logik mit negativen Bedingungen:
Unser System sucht und schließt nur Kontakte ein, die nicht über alle in Ihrem Segment aufgeführten Tags verfügen.
Wenn ein Kontakt beispielsweise über das Tag „Champion“, aber nicht über das Tag „Neu“ verfügt, wird er nicht in das obige Segment aufgenommen. Dies liegt daran, dass er die Bedingung „Tag existiert nicht, Champion“ nicht erfüllt haben.
Da wir die logische Bedingung „UND“ verwenden, werden mit dem Segment nur Kontakte abgeglichen, die alle Bedingungen erfüllen.
Anwendungsfall mit Beispielkontakten
Wie das funktioniert, zeigen die Beispielkontakte und das obige Bild:
- Macy Doe und Martino Doe werden beide in dieser Bedingung auftreten. Sie haben weder den Tag „Champion“ noch den Tag „Neu“. Daher erfüllen sie sämtliche Segmentbedingungen. Beachten Sie, dass Macy Doe keine Tags hat, also erfüllt sie auch dieses Segment.
- Jane Doe hat beide Tags und wird nicht angezeigt.
Beispiel 3: „UND“-Logik mit sowohl positiven als auch negativen Bedingungen
Nehmen wir als drittes Beispiel an, Sie erstellen ein Segment, das eine Mischung aus positiven und negativen Bedingungen mit der „UND“-Logik verwendet:
Unser System umfasst Kontakte, die das Tag „engagiert“ haben, aber nicht sowohl das Tag „Champion“ als auch das Tag „Neu“.
Da wir die logische Bedingung „UND“ verwenden, werden mit dem Segment nur Kontakte abgeglichen, die alle diese Bedingungen erfüllen.
Anwendungsfall mit Beispielkontakten
So funktioniert es anhand der Beispielkontakte und dem Bild oben:
- Martino Doe wird angezeigt, weil er das Tag „engagiert“ hat, nicht das Tag „Champion“ und nicht das Tag „neu“.
- Jane Doe wird nicht angezeigt, da sie zwar das Tag „engagiert“ hat, aber auch die Tags „Champion“ und „neu“. Diese Bedingung sucht nach Kontakten ohne das Tag „Champion“ und „neu“.
- Macy Doe wird nicht angezeigt und erfüllt diese Bedingung nicht, da sie nicht über das Tag „engagiert“ verfügt.
„ODER“-Logikbedingung
Mit der logischen Bedingung „ODER“ betrachtet unser System jede Bedingung unabhängig. Dies bedeutet, dass Kontakte nur eine Ihrer Bedingungen erfüllen müssen, um aufgenommen zu werden. Die Bedingungen in diesem Segmenttyp sind NICHT voneinander abhängig, sodass „ODER“-Bedingungen Ihre Ergebnisse erweitern.
Nachfolgend finden Sie drei Beispiele zur Veranschaulichung der „ODER“-Logik und der zu erwartenden Ergebnisse:
Beispiel 1: „ODER“-Logik mit positiven Bedingungen
Angenommen, Sie erstellen ein Segment, das die „ODER“-Logik mit positiven Bedingungen verwendet:
So sucht und schließt unser System Kontakte basierend auf diesem Segmenttyp ein:
- Wir prüfen zunächst, ob einer Ihrer Kontakte das Tag „engagiert“ hat. Wenn wir Kontakte mit diesem Tag finden, werden sie in Ihr Segment aufgenommen.
- Wir prüfen dann, ob einer Ihrer Kontakte das Tag „Champion“ hat. Wenn wir Kontakte mit diesem Tag finden, werden sie auch in Ihr Segment aufgenommen.
- Zuletzt prüfen wir, ob einer Ihrer Kontakte das Tag „Neu“ hat. Wenn wir Kontakte mit diesem Tag finden, werden sie auch in Ihr Segment aufgenommen.
Da diese Bedingungen unabhängig voneinander sind, werden Kontakte einbezogen, die mindestens eine der drei Bedingungen erfüllen. Wenn ein Kontakt beispielsweise über das Tag „engagiert“ verfügt, die anderen beiden Tags jedoch nicht, wird er dennoch in Ihr Segment aufgenommen.
Anwendungsfall mit Beispielkontakten
Wie das funktioniert, zeigen die Beispielkontakte und das obige Bild:
- Martino Doe und Jane Doe werden beide angezeigt, da sie mindestens eines der Tags im Segment haben.
- Macy Doe erscheint nicht, da sie keine Tags hat und das Segment nicht erfüllt.
Beispiel 2: „ODER“-Logik mit negativen Bedingungen
Nehmen wir nun an, Sie erstellen ein Segment mit „ODER“-Logik mit negativen Bedingungen:
So sucht und schließt unser System Kontakte basierend auf diesem Segmenttyp ein:
- Wir prüfen zunächst, ob einer Ihrer Kontakte NICHT über das Tag „engaged“ verfügt. Wenn wir Kontakte finden, die dieses Tag nicht haben, werden sie in Ihr Segment aufgenommen.
- Wir prüfen dann, ob einer Ihrer Kontakte NICHT über das Tag „Champion“ verfügt. Wenn wir Kontakte finden, die dieses Tag nicht haben, werden sie ebenfalls in Ihr Segment aufgenommen.
- Zuletzt prüfen wir, ob einer Ihrer Kontakte NICHT das Tag „neu“ hat. Wenn wir Kontakte finden, die dieses Tag nicht haben, werden sie ebenfalls zu Ihrem Segment hinzugefügt.
Da wir wiederum die logische Bedingung „ODER“ verwenden, muss ein Kontakt nur eine dieser Bedingungen erfüllen, um in Ihr Segment aufgenommen zu werden. Dabei spielt es keine Rolle, ob die anderen Voraussetzungen erfüllt sind. Er wird dennoch in Ihr Segment aufgenommen.
Dies bedeutet, dass ein Kontakt in Ihr Segment aufgenommen wird, wenn er NICHT mit dem Tag „neu“ gekennzeichnet ist, aber mit dem Tag „engagiert“. Dies liegt daran, dass sie die Bedingung „Tag existiert NICHT, neu“ erfüllt haben.
Wenn Sie Kontakte ausschließen möchten, die nicht über das Tag „neu“, „engagiert“ und „Champion“ verfügen, empfehlen wir die Verwendung einer „UND“-Anweisung anstelle einer „ODER“-Anweisung.
Anwendungsfall mit Beispielkontakten
Wie das funktioniert, zeigen die Beispielkontakte und das obige Bild:
- Martino Doe erscheint, weil er zwar das Tag „engagiert“ hat, aber nicht das Tag „Champion“ und daher die Bedingung „Tag existiert NICHT, Champion“ erfüllt. Da Martino mindestens eine Bedingung erfüllt, wird er in dem Segment erscheinen. Martino erfüllt jedoch auch die Bedingung „Tag existiert NICHT, neu“.
- Macy Doe wird angezeigt, weil sie keine Tags hat und die Bedingung „Tag existiert NICHT, engagiert“ erfüllt. Auch hier gilt: Da Macy mindestens eine Bedingung erfüllt, wird sie in dem Segment erscheinen, aber technisch gesehen erfüllt sie alle drei Bedingungen.
- Jane Doe wird nicht angezeigt, da sie alle drei dieser Tags hat und keine der Bedingungen erfüllt.
Beispiel 3: „ODER“-Logik mit sowohl positiven als auch negativen Bedingungen
Als drittes Beispiel nehmen wir an, Sie erstellen ein Segment, das eine Mischung aus positiven und negativen Aussagen mit der logischen Bedingung „ODER“ verwendet:
So sucht und schließt unser System Kontakte basierend auf diesem Segmenttyp ein:
- Wir suchen zunächst nach Kontakten, die das Tag „engagiert“ haben. Wenn wir Kontakte mit diesem Tag finden, werden sie in Ihr Segment aufgenommen.
- Anschließend suchen wir nach Kontakten, die NICHT das Tag „Champion“ haben. Wenn wir Kontakte finden, die NICHT über dieses Tag verfügen, werden auch diese in Ihr Segment aufgenommen.
- Zuletzt suchen wir nach Kontakten, die das Tag „neu“ haben. Wenn wir Kontakte finden, die dieses Tag haben, werden auch sie zu Ihrem Segment hinzugefügt.
Da wir wiederum die logische Bedingung „ODER“ verwenden, muss ein Kontakt nur eine dieser Bedingungen erfüllen, um in Ihr Segment aufgenommen zu werden. Dabei spielt es keine Rolle, ob die anderen Voraussetzungen erfüllt sind. Er wird dennoch in Ihr Segment aufgenommen.
Anwendungsfall mit Beispielkontakten
Unter Verwendung unserer Beispielkontakte und dem obigen Bild erscheinen alle drei. Hier ist der Grund dafür:
- Macy Doe wird angezeigt, weil sie keine Tags hat und die Bedingung „Tag existiert NICHT, Champion“ erfüllt. Da Macy mindestens eine Bedingung erfüllt, wird sie in dem Segment auftreten. Sie erfüllt jedoch auch die Bedingung „Tag existiert NICHT, neu“.
- Martino Doe wird angezeigt, weil er über das „engagiert“-Tag verfügt und die Bedingung „Tag existiert, engagiert“ erfüllt. Da Martino mindestens eine Bedingung erfüllt, wird er in dem Segment erscheinen. Er erfüllt jedoch auch die Bedingungen „Tag existiert NICHT, engagiert“ und „Tag existiert NICHT, Champion“.
- Jane Doe wird angezeigt, weil sie das Tag „engagiert“ hat und die Bedingung „Tag existiert, engagiert“ erfüllt.
Da diese Kontakte jeweils mindestens eine der Bedingungen erfüllen, erscheinen sie im Segment.